  NHTSA Recall 97V164000

NHTSA Campaign Id 97V164000; Date: Sep. 22, 1997

This main frame should not fracture but bend after an impact.

icon1 Recalled Vehicles:

1997 Triumph Triumph

Component: Structure:frame And Members

Manufactured by: Triumph Motorcycles

Affected Units:: 297

icon3 Recall Summary:

Vehicle description: motorcycles. Following an accident impact, weld fractures can occur on the main frame in the head stock area.

icon2 How to Fix:

Dealers will replace these frames with newly manufactured frames.

icon4 Recall Notes:

Owner notification began October 1, 1997. Owners who take their motorcycles to an authorized dealer on an agreed upon service date and do not receive the free remedy within a reasonable time should contact triumphat 1-678-854-2010. Also contact the national highway traffic safety administration's auto safety hotline at 1-800-424-9393.

Date Owners notified by Manufacturer: Oct 1, 1997
